Understanding Your AC Installation Options
The modern HVAC market offers numerous air conditioning technologies, each with specific advantages for different home configurations and cooling requirements. Central air conditioning systems remain the most popular choice for Elgin homeowners, utilizing existing ductwork to distribute cooled air throughout the entire house. These systems typically consist of an outdoor condensing unit containing the compressor and condenser coil, paired with an indoor air handler housing the evaporator coil and blower motor. The refrigerant cycle between these components removes heat and humidity from indoor air, creating the comfortable environment you expect during those intense Oklahoma summers.
For homes without existing ductwork or those seeking zone-specific cooling control, ductless mini-split systems provide an excellent alternative. These systems feature individual air handlers mounted in specific rooms or zones, connected to an outdoor unit through refrigerant lines and electrical wiring. This configuration eliminates the energy losses associated with ductwork while allowing customized temperature control in different areas of your home. Heat pump systems offer another versatile option, providing both heating and cooling capabilities through a single system that reverses the refrigeration cycle seasonally. These units prove particularly efficient in Elgin’s climate, where moderate winter temperatures allow heat pumps to operate effectively year-round.
The Installation Process and Timeline
Our AC installation process follows a systematic approach designed to minimize disruption to your daily routine while ensuring every component functions correctly. The installation typically begins with preparing the installation site, which includes creating a level pad for the outdoor unit and ensuring proper clearances for airflow and maintenance access. We carefully position the outdoor condensing unit to optimize performance while considering factors such as noise levels, aesthetic preferences, and local building codes specific to Elgin and surrounding areas.
Inside your home, our technicians install the evaporator coil within the air handler or furnace plenum, ensuring proper alignment and secure connections. The refrigerant lines connecting indoor and outdoor components require precise installation techniques, including proper brazing, insulation, and protection from physical damage. We take special care when routing these lines through walls or attics, maintaining appropriate slopes for oil return and preventing potential leak points. The electrical connections demand equal attention, as we install dedicated circuits, disconnects, and control wiring according to National Electrical Code requirements and manufacturer specifications.
Energy Efficiency Considerations and SEER Ratings
Energy efficiency plays a crucial role in selecting and installing your new air conditioning system, directly impacting both environmental sustainability and long-term operating costs. The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io (SEER) measures cooling output divided by energy consumption over an entire cooling season, with higher ratings indicating greater efficiency. Current federal regulations require minimum SEER ratings of 14 for new installations in our region, though we often recommend systems with SEER ratings of 16 or higher for optimal energy savings in Elgin’s climate.
Advanced features contributing to higher efficiency ratings include variable-speed compressors that adjust cooling output based on demand, reducing energy consumption during partial-load conditions. Two-stage cooling systems offer intermediate capacity levels, allowing longer run times at lower speeds for improved humidity control and temperature consistency. Smart thermostats integrated with these systems enable precise scheduling, remote monitoring, and adaptive learning algorithms that optimize cooling cycles based on your family’s patterns and preferences.
Ensuring Long-Term Performance Through Proper Installation
The quality of your AC installation directly influences system performance, reliability, and longevity throughout its operational life. Proper refrigerant charging proves critical, as both undercharging and overcharging negatively affect cooling capacity, energy efficiency, and component lifespan. We utilize precise measurement techniques, including superheat and subcooling calculations, to verify optimal refrigerant levels according to manufacturer specifications and ambient conditions.
- Ductwork evaluation and sealing: inspecting existing ducts for leaks, damage, or sizing issues that could compromise system performance
- Airflow verification: measuring and adjusting airflow rates across evaporator coils to ensure proper heat transfer and prevent freezing
- Drainage system installation: configuring condensate lines with appropriate slopes and overflow protection to prevent water damage
- Control system programming: setting up thermostats, zone controls, and safety devices for optimal operation and protection
- System commissioning: conducting comprehensive performance tests to verify cooling capacity, temperature splits, and electrical parameters
